Kaua‘i launches surge testing program
LĪHU‘E – Mayor Derek S. K. Kawakami announced that the county is launching a free
COVID-19 surge testing program available every Sunday, and urged hospitality industry staff
and uninsured residents to participate.
“Free testing is open to everyone regardless of health insurance or symptoms,” said
Mayor Kawakami. “We want to encourage our hospitality industry staff who work closely with
visitors to get tested, to help protect their family and friends and our entire community. Tests are
free to everyone, including those who are un-insured. Testing sites will rotate every Sunday
between Līhuʻe, Kapa‘a, and Hanapēpē, beginning this weekend.”
The County of Kaua‘i, in partnership with the Hawai‘i Department of Health, is providing
free COVID-19 testing at rotating sites every Sunday through the end of the year. The program
is intended to provide regular access for hospitality industry staff who work closely with visitors
and are at an increased risk of infection.
Testing is available every Sunday, 9 a.m. to 3 p.m., through the end of 2020:
November 8: Līhuʻe - Vidinha Stadium
November 15: Kapa‘a - Bryan J. Baptiste Sports Complex
November 22: Hanapēpē Stadium
November 29: Līhuʻe - Vidinha Stadium
December 6: Kapa‘a - Bryan J. Baptiste Sports Complex
December 13: Hanapēpē Stadium
December 20: Līhuʻe - Vidinha Stadium
December 27: Kapa‘a - Bryan J. Baptiste Sports Complex
Participants are asked to register in advance at doineedacovid19test.com. Limited on-
site registration will be available for those who are unable to register online.
Hospitality staff includes individuals of all ages working at hotels, restaurants/bars, tour
companies, transportation companies, etc. Testing will also be available to those with poor
access to COVID-19 testing, such as those who are under or uninsured.
These tests are not part of the state’s pre-travel testing program and cannot be
used for quarantine exemptions.
